I recently bought a 2011 Genesis Sedan 4.6. Had to have the electronic emergency brake assembly replaced recently because a 6 inch strip of the emergency/parking brake literally broke off inside the rotor hub. Replaced both rear rotors (to keep it even wear) and the electronic emergency brake assembly was installed by a back yard mechanic friend.
It worked fine for a couple of weeks (use it periodically only) but the other day I parked and turned ON the electronic EBP and I heard a loud screeching sound. I managed to click the EEBP switch to off by pulling up on it TWICE and it stopped the screeching (ie it released).

When I click the EEBP on to now test it- it immediately starts screeching as though “stop” sensor or actuator (?) is no longer functioning. Nothing is signaling the EEBP to stop (since engaged)/ or to tell the car that the EEBP is now in place to hold the brake.
A shop told me they could look at it (next day) but he said it sounds like an issue for a dealership. I want to avoid dealerships.
To summarize, previously when I turned on the EEPB, it would make the regular hum and click noise. But now it’s a hum and SCREECH noise until I disengage it at the lower dash switch.

Update :

Dropped my car off at local Hyundai dealer on the 16th, told I had 30+ cars in front of me, followed up several times and slowly moved up the list. Today I called and was told it was just pulled in and informed just the module and cables were 2,133 bucks (WTF)!!!! Was called again to ask permission to proceed with repair, total price with labor to install and program the unit will be 2,643.78. I hope no one has to get this fixed anytime soon because this is crazy expensive on a almost ten year old platform.
